摘要
Establishing the quantum wireless communication network model in first, obtaining the information sent by the source side through the establishment of the quantum channel relay points at both ends secondly, and finally to realize the transmission of multi-level quantum wireless network information. On the basis of classical authentication, quantum teleportation and entanglement swapping technology are adopted to carry information to realize the wireless communication network identity authentication. In combination to quantum search algorithm, we search the paths with maximum routing metrics in a limited hop counts as the target solution path, so that it can avoid the disconnection due to the consumption of the entangled quantum pairs, ensure the success rates, reduce the network computation complexity of quantum communication network, and fast the convergence of route search.
